How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Racquet Club South?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Racquet Club South Studio Apartments | $2,285 | $2,285 | $2,285 |
| Racquet Club South 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,869 | $1,445 | $3,010 |
| Racquet Club South 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,158 | $1,865 | $4,374 |
| Racquet Club South 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,475 | $2,475 | $2,475 |
How much does it cost to rent a home in Racquet Club South?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2 Bedroom Homes | $3,468 | $1,600 | $10,000+ |
| 3 Bedroom Homes | $5,350 | $2,295 | $10,000+ |
| 4 Bedroom Homes | $6,948 | $3,245 | $10,000+ |
| 5 Bedroom Homes | $14,935 | $3,745 | $10,000+ |
| 6 Bedroom Homes | $12,243 | $4,975 | $10,000+ |
